Energy consumption and weather data collected continuously during a period of 29 months at Challenger building (France).
<p>The dataset consists of energy consumption and weather data collected continuously during a period of 29 months at Challenger building (France).</p> <p>Energy consumption data at 10 minutes intervals include:</p> <ul> <li>Heating and cooling electrical consumption (indoor and outdoor comfort units) for the 8 zones in the South Triangle (kWh)</li> <li>Lighting consumption for the 8 zones in the South Triangle (kWh)</li> <li>Plug load consumption for the 8 zones in the South Triangle (kWh)</li> <li>Sanitary consumption for the 8 zones in the South Triangle (kWh)</li> <li>Blinds consumption for the 8 zones in the South Triangle (kWh)</li> <li>Air handling unit consumption for the South Triangle (kWh)</li> <li>Total electrical consumption for the South Triangle (kWh)</li> <li>Thermal energy consumption for VRF (Variable refrigerant flow) units of the South Triangle (kWh)</li> </ul> <p>Weather data include:</p> <ul> <li>Daily degree days (°C)</li> <li>Hourly humidity (%)</li> <li>Daily rain precipitation (mm)</li> <li>Hourly direct and global radiation (J/cm2)</li> <li>Daily sunshine hours (hrs)</li> <li>Hourly temperature (°C)</li> </ul> <p>The data set contains<br> - Timeseries as CSV files<br> - Timeseries metadata (description, unit, type,...) as JSON file</p> <p>The data have been made available from the BMS database, thanks to the BEMServer open-source platform - <a href="http://www.bemserver.org">www.bemserver.org</a>, developed in the HIT2GAP project that has received funding from the European Union's Horizon 2020 research and innovation programme under grant agreement n. 680708 - <a href="http://www.hit2gap.eu">www.hit2gap.eu</a>.</p>

Data from energy meters of the NANOGUNE building (Spain)
<p>The dataset consists of measured values from all the energy meters installed in Nanogune building located in San Sebastian (Spain). These meters differentiate between the electricity consumption of the intensive production equipment (chillers, clean room, laboratories, etc.) and the one related to the rest of the installation (offices, lighting, common areas, etc.). They also reflect the thermal consumption data (cold and heat) of each area of Nanogune building. </p> <p>There are 79 meters in total: 58 of them are electric meters, 20 thermal meters (10 cold, 10 heat) and a gas meter. All the meters have a time step of 15 minutes, and the data set covers a period of 5 months. </p> <p>The data set contains<br> - Timeseries as CSV files<br> - Timeseries metadata (description, unit, type,...) as JSON file</p> <p>The data have been made available from the BMS database, thanks to the BEMServer open-source platform - <a href="http://www.bemserver.org">www.bemserver.org</a>, developed in the HIT2GAP project that has received funding from the European Union's Horizon 2020 research and innovation programme under grant agreement n. 680708 - <a href="http://www.hit2gap.eu">www.hit2gap.eu</a>.</p>

Betaine–based natural deep eutectic solvents as sustainable electrolytes for the electrochemical energy storage devices
<p><span>The research project titled: <em>"</em></span><span><em><span>Betaine–based natural deep eutectic solvents as sustainable electrolytes for the electrochemical energy storage devices</span></em></span><em><span>"</span></em><span> focused on developing new, environmentally friendly liquid electrolytes for use in devices such as batteries, accumulators, and capacitors. The researchers concentrated on the development of so-called Natural Deep Eutectic Solvents (NADES) based on betaine and its derivatives, which have the potential to replace traditional, less eco-friendly electrolytes.</span></p> <p><span>Betaine is a natural chemical compound in plants like sugar beets, making it a fully renewable resource. Chemically, betaine is a derivative of the amino acid glycine, meaning it possesses a positive functional group at one end of the molecule and a negative charge at the opposite end. This gives betaine the characteristics of an ionic compound known as a zwitterion, which can be successfully used as <span>an electrolyte additive.</span></span></p> <p><span><span>During the </span>research, three different NADESs were synthesized, and betaine hydrochloride served as the hydrogen bond acceptor (HBA). At the same time, glycerol, ethylene glycol, and glycolic acid acted as hydrogen bond donors (HBD). The researchers then examined their physical properties, such as density, viscosity, pH, and conductivity, and assessed these substances' electrochemical stability.</span></p> <p><span>Among the studied NADES, the one based on betaine hydrochloride as the HBA and ethylene glycol as the HBD proved to be the most suitable electrolyte for supercapacitors due to its low viscosity and high ionic conductivity. Tests involving this substance demonstrated that devices using this electrolyte exhibited high specific capacitance and stability during prolonged use.</span></p> <p><span>The results confirm that NADES based on betaine can serve as a more sustainable alternative to conventional electrolytes, which is a step toward creating more environmentally friendly energy storage systems in the future.</span></p> <p><span>This research was founded on the whole by the National Science Centre, Poland (grant No. 2023/07/X/ST5/00629). Data from: Alternative splicing substantially diversifies the transcriptome during early photomorphogenesis and correlates with the energy availability in Arabidopsis
Plants use light as source of energy and information to detect diurnal rhythms and seasonal changes. Sensing changing light conditions is critical to adjust plant metabolism and to initiate developmental transitions. Here we analyzed transcriptome-wide alterations in gene expression and alternative splicing (AS) of etiolated seedlings undergoing photomorphogenesis upon exposure to blue, red, or white light. Our analysis revealed massive transcriptome reprograming as reflected by differential expression of ~20% of all genes and changes in several hundred AS events. For more than 60% of all regulated AS events, light promoted the production of a presumably protein-coding variant at the expense of an mRNA with nonsense-mediated decay-triggering features. Accordingly, AS of the putative splicing factor REDUCED RED-LIGHT RESPONSES IN CRY1CRY2 BACKGROUND 1 (RRC1), previously identified as a red light signaling component, was shifted to the functional variant under light. Downstream analyses of candidate AS events pointed at a role of photoreceptor signaling only in monochromatic but not in white light. Furthermore, we demonstrated similar AS changes upon light exposure and exogenous sugar supply, with a critical involvement of kinase signaling. We propose that AS is an integration point of signaling pathways that sense and transmit information regarding the energy availability in plants.
